摘要
The Knoevenagel adducts of 2-aroyl-3,3-bis(alkylsulfanyl)acrylaldehydes and malononitrile were cyclized in the presence of diisopropylamine to afford 5-aroyl-2,6-bis(methylsulfanyl)nicotinonitriles. Cyclization in the presence of aqueous ammonia gave 2-amino-5-aroyl-6-(methylsulfanyl) nicotinonitriles. A multicomponent reaction involving aroylketene dithioacetals, malononitrile and Vilsmeier reagent gave 5-aroyl-2-chloro-6-(methylsulfanyl)nicotinonitrile.
